Several key factors are propelling the growth of the Beta Molecular Sieve market. The rising demand for efficient catalysts in the petrochemical and refining industries is a major driver, as Beta molecular sieves offer superior performance compared to traditional catalysts. Their exceptional shape-selectivity and high thermal stability make them ideal for various catalytic processes, leading to increased efficiency and reduced production costs. The growing adoption of Beta molecular sieves in the production of fine chemicals and pharmaceuticals further contributes to market expansion. Their ability to selectively adsorb and separate molecules with high precision is crucial in synthesizing complex compounds with high purity, driving demand from the pharmaceutical and specialty chemical sectors. Furthermore, the increasing focus on environmental sustainability is boosting the market, as Beta molecular sieves are used in environmentally friendly processes like the removal of pollutants and purification of industrial emissions. The development of innovative applications in areas such as gas separation and storage is also contributing to market growth. As research and development efforts continue to uncover new applications for Beta molecular sieves, their market penetration is expected to expand even further. These advancements, coupled with the ongoing demand from established industries, firmly establish Beta molecular sieves as a critical component in various industrial processes, ensuring continued market expansion.
Despite the promising growth trajectory, several challenges and restraints hinder the Beta Molecular Sieve market's expansion. One significant constraint is the high cost of production and purification of high-quality Beta molecular sieves. This factor limits wider adoption, particularly in price-sensitive markets. Competition from alternative adsorbents and catalysts with potentially lower production costs also presents a challenge. Furthermore, f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ly zeolites, can impact the overall production costs and profitability of Beta molecular sieve manufacturers. The technological complexity involved in the synthesis and application of Beta molecular sieves can also pose a challenge for smaller players seeking entry into the market. Stringent regulatory requirements and environmental standards in various regions add another layer of complexity to production and distribution, potentially increasing operational costs for manufacturers. Finally, the research and development landscape is ever-evolving, and the need for continuous innovation to meet emerging industry demands represents a continuous challenge for companies looking to maintain a competitive edge. Overcoming these challenges requires innovative production techniques, strategic partnerships, and consistent investment in R&D.
